Seattle Home Prices Up 9% Since February

Home prices in the Seattle area seem to be picking up as inventory drops and home buyers begin to build confidence.  The number of multiple-offer situations and "bidding wars" has increased significantly in recent months.

The Seattle Times reported seeing a 9 percent increase home prices since February of this year.  In the city of Seattle, prices are up 3 percent from one year ago.  Neighborhoods close to Seattle and Bellevue continue to report stronger home sales, while those in outlying areas have yet to pick up.

Total home sales are also on the rise, with 8 percent increase in total house sales across King County.  Condos saw an even stronger gain, with a 22 percent increase over March of 2010.
